We’ve written before on this blog about the consulting industry’s historic challenges around diversity and inclusion; while firms are no longer the “old boys’ clubs” they once were, most still have a long way to go before they become truly reflective of the societies in which they operate. People of colour remain under-represented at many firms, particularly at the partner level.

The right answer

Seth Godin Blog

Which is better: Feeling like you were right the first time or actually being correct now? When we double down on our original estimate, defend our sunk costs and rally behind the home team, we’re doing this because it’s satisfying to feel as though we were right all along.
